阅读量:2
JMeter的吞吐量和并发数之间有着密切的关系。以下是它们之间的关系:
吞吐量(Throughput):吞吐量是指在给定时间内完成的请求数量。在JMeter中,通过每秒钟发送的请求数量来衡量吞吐量。吞吐量可以用来评估系统的性能和负载能力。
并发数(Concurrency):并发数是指同时进行的请求数量。在JMeter中,通过线程数来表示并发数。每个线程代表一个用户或一个并发请求。并发数可以用来模拟多个用户同时访问系统的情况。
在JMeter中,吞吐量和并发数之间的关系可以通过以下公式来计算:
吞吐量 = 并发数 / 平均响应时间
这意味着,如果并发数增加,而平均响应时间保持不变,那么吞吐量将增加。另外,如果并发数增加,而平均响应时间增加,那么吞吐量将减少。
需要注意的是,并发数的增加可能会导致系统的负载增加,从而影响系统的性能。因此,在进行性能测试时,需要根据系统的负载能力和性能需求来选择合适的并发数,以达到期望的吞吐量。